Magnetometry, as talked about above, is a passive strategy measuring local variations in magnetism against a localised absolutely no worth. Magnetic vulnerability survey is an active technique: it is a measure of how magnetic a sample of sediment might be in the existence of an electromagnetic field. Just how much soil is checked depends upon the size of the test coil: it can be really small or it can be relatively big.

The sensing unit in this case is really small and samples a tiny sample of soil. The Bartington magnetic susceptibility meter with a large "field coil" in usage at Verulamium throughout the course in 2013. Leading soil will be magnetically enhanced compared to subsoils simply due to natural oxidation and decrease.

By determining magnetic susceptibility at a fairly coarse scale, we can discover locations of human profession and middens. At the Wildcat site, the magnetometer survey had actually found a range of features and homes. The magnetic susceptibility study assisted, however, specify the primary area of profession and midden which surrounded the more open location.

Jarrod Burks' magnetic vulnerability survey arises from the Wildcat site, Ohio. Red is high, blue is low. The strategy is for that reason of great usage in defining locations of basic occupation instead of determining particular functions.
